[PATCH 2/3] KVM: arm/arm64: fix HYP ID map extension to 52 bits

Commit fa2a8445b1d3 incorrectly masks the index of the HYP ID map pgd
entry, causing a non-VHE kernel to hang during boot. This happens when
VA_BITS=48 and the ID map text is in 52-bit physical memory. In this
case we don't need an extra table level but need more entries in the
top-level table, so we need to map into hyp_pgd and need to use
__kvm_idmap_ptrs_per_pgd to mask in the extra bits. However,
__create_hyp_mappings currently masks by PTRS_PER_PGD instead.

Fix it so that we always use __kvm_idmap_ptrs_per_pgd for the HYP ID
map. This ensures that we use the larger mask for the top-level ID map
table when it has more entries. In all other cases, PTRS_PER_PGD is used
as normal.

Fixes: fa2a8445b1d3 ("arm64: allow ID map to be extended to 52 bits")
